Hi I just did a new installation of Suse 11.2 and found that I couldn't connect to mysql from a php script because mysql.sock was in /var/run/mysql/mysql.sock rather than /var/lib/mysql/mysql.sock. I changed all the lines in /etc/my.cnf for the socket to /var/lib/mysql/mysql.sock. Now my php scripts connect but I can't connect to mysql from the command line. I get the error can't connect through socket /var/run/mysql/mysql.sock. What do I have to change to make the konsole use /var/lib/mysql/mysql.sock?
